The night of December 25-26, 1776, was a defining moment in the American Revolution. General George Washington and his Continental Army crossed the icy Delaware River and launched a surprise attack on Hessian mercenaries in Trenton, New Jersey. The victory at Trenton was a major turning point in the war, giving the Americans a much-needed boost of morale and convincing foreign powers that the American cause was worth supporting.

Background

By the winter of 1776, the American Revolution was at a low point. The Continental Army had been defeated in several major battles, and morale was low. Washington's army was encamped in Pennsylvania, across the Delaware River from Trenton. The Hessians, who were hired by the British to fight in the war, were stationed in Trenton.

Washington decided to cross the Delaware River and attack the Hessians on Christmas night. He knew that the Hessians would be celebrating the holiday and would be less likely to expect an attack. The plan was risky, but Washington believed that it was their only chance to turn the tide of the war.

The Crossing

On Christmas night, Washington and his men boarded boats and crossed the Delaware River. The crossing was difficult, and several boats were swamped. However, Washington and his men eventually made it to the other side.

They then marched to Trenton and attacked the Hessians. The Hessians were surprised by the attack and were quickly overwhelmed. Washington's army captured over 900 Hessians and several cannons.

Aftermath

The victory at Trenton was a major turning point in the American Revolution. It gave the Americans a much-needed boost of morale and convinced foreign powers that the American cause was worth supporting. The victory also helped to convince the British that they could not easily defeat the Americans.
